Hubbell Incorporated
Hubbell Incorporated is a global manufacturer of utility and electrical solutions. Our dependable products and services enable customers to operate safely, reliably, efficiently, and sustainably.
Our portfolio of 70 well-respected brands work together to add value for our users. With a tradition of quality and innovation built more than a century ago, our solutions empower and energize communities in front of and behind the meter.
Where We Began:
The Hubbell history of innovation extends back to 1888. Founder Harvey Hubbell developed tooling and equipment to serve the growing demand for manufacturing machinery during the industrial revolution.
The advent of the light bulb and electric power opened new opportunities for our company. Hubbell invented new ways to serve our growing customer base of businesses, manufacturers, utilities, and homeowners. Early patents include the “pull chain lamp socket” and “separable plug and receptacle” we still use today.
